...
首页> 外文期刊>Journal of Parallel and Distributed Computing >Blockchain based privacy-preserving software updates with proof-of-delivery for Internet of Things
【24h】

Blockchain based privacy-preserving software updates with proof-of-delivery for Internet of Things

机译:基于区块链的隐私保护软件更新以及物联网的交付证明

获取原文
获取原文并翻译 | 示例
   

获取外文期刊封面封底 >>

       

摘要

A large number of loT devices are connected via the Internet. However, most of these loT devices are generally not perfect-by-design even have security weaknesses or vulnerabilities. Thus, it is essential to update these loT devices securely, patching their vulnerabilities and protecting the safety of the involved users. Existing studies deliver secure and reliable updates based on blockchain network which serves as the transmission network. However, these approaches could compromise users privacy when updating the loT devices.In this paper, we propose a new blockchain based privacy-preserving software update protocol, which delivers secure and reliable updates with an incentive mechanism while protects the privacy of involved users. A vendor delivers the updates and makes a commitment by using smart contract to provide financial incentive to the transmission nodes who deliver the updates to its loT devices. A transmission node can get financial incentive by providing a proof-of-delivery. In order to obtain the proof-of-delivery, the transmission node uses double authentication preventing signature (DAPS) to carry out fair exchange. Specifically, the transmission node uses the DAPS to exchange an attribute based signature (ABS) of one loT device. Then, it uses the ABS as proof-of-delivery to receive financial incentives. Generally, to generate an ABS, the loT device has to execute complex computations which is intolerable for resource limited devices. We propose a concrete outsourced attribute-based signature (OABS) scheme to overcome the weakness. Then, we prove the security of the proposed OABS and the protocol. Finally, we implement smart contract in Solidity to demonstrate the validity of the proposed protocol. (C) 2019 Elsevier Inc. All rights reserved.
机译:大量的loT设备通过Internet连接。但是,大多数这些loT设备通常都不是设计完美的,甚至存在安全漏洞或漏洞。因此,安全地更新这些loT设备,修补其漏洞并保护相关用户的安全至关重要。现有研究基于作为传输网络的区块链网络提供安全可靠的更新。但是,这些方法可能会在更新loT设备时危及用户隐私。本文提出了一种基于区块链的新隐私保护软件更新协议,该协议通过激励机制提供安全可靠的更新,同时保护相关用户的隐私。卖方通过使用智能合约交付更新并做出承诺,以向向其loT设备交付更新的传输节点提供财务激励。传输节点可以通过提供交付证明来获得财务激励。为了获得交货证明,传输节点使用双重认证防止签名(DAPS)进行公平交换。具体而言,传输节点使用DAPS交换一个loT设备的基于属性的签名(ABS)。然后,它使用ABS作为交付证明来获得经济激励。通常,为了生成ABS,loT设备必须执行资源有限的设备无法忍受的复杂计算。我们提出了一个具体的外包基于属性的签名(OABS)方案来克服这一弱点。然后,我们证明了所提出的OABS和协议的安全性。最后,我们在Solidity中实施智能合约以证明所提出协议的有效性。 (C)2019 Elsevier Inc.保留所有权利。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号